Year 1 - 3

Question: Tori has reading homework that is 19 pages long. The homework is printed front-and back on sheets of paper. How many sheets of paper are needed for the whole reading assignment?

Year 4 - 6

Question: Sebastian completed 4 maths assignments, 5 writing assignments, 7 reading assignments, 3 history assignments, and 1 science assignment last week. Fill in the pie chart below with Sebastian’s homework assignments.

Year 6 - 9

Question: Lisa needs to memorize the locations of all 54 countries in Africa for a geography test that will be 30 days from now. She memorizes 7 countries every 3 days. Every 2 days, she forgets a country and needs to re-memorize it. Will she have enough time to memorize all of the countries in Africa for her geography test?

Year 9+

Question: Logan has answered 4/5 as many maths questions as Spanish questions, and he’s answered 5 more English questions than Spanish questions. If Logan has answered 33 questions in total, how many maths questions has Logan answered?
